Course Description

Evan Weiner, award winning journalist, author

Most of us were glued to the TV screen on August 9, 1974 as Richard Nixon became the first US president forced to resign after the Watergate Scandal. From “Tricky Dick’s” exiting the White House to the First lady of Television, Lucille Ball’s exit from the situation comedy stage to John Lennon’s last public appearance on stage, 1974 was an eventful and fascinating year. Headlines to be discussed also include: Gerald Ford becoming the 38th President of the United States, the coup in Portugal, toppled governments in Ethiopia and Greece, Patty Hearst’s kidnapping  and more. Join us for an insightful trip down memory lane.  (includes lunch)
